Matar Paneer Sandwich
Matar Paneer Sandwich is a delicious fusion snack that brings together the rich, spiced flavors of North Indian matar paneer (peas and cottage cheese) with the convenience of a toasted sandwich. Made with a flavorful mixture of sautéed peas, crumbled paneer, and aromatic spices, it's layered between slices of bread and grilled to perfection. Ideal for breakfast, lunch, or as a tea-time snack, this sandwich is both filling and nutritious, offering a quick and satisfying twist on traditional Indian flavors.

For Matar Paneer Filling
- Butter – 1½ tbsp
- Cumin – 1 tsp
- Green Peas – 1½ cups
- Paneer, crushed – 1 cup or 125 gms
- Salt – to taste
- Onion, finely chopped – 4 tbsp
- Ginger, finely chopped – 2 tsp
- Green chilli, chopped – 1 no
- Salt – to taste
- Coriander seeds, pounded – 2 tbsp
- Chilli Powder – 1 tsp
- Kasoori methi leaves – a pinch
- Chaat Masala – 2 tsp
- Anardana, pounded – 2 tsp
- Garam Masala – ½ tsp
- Coriander, chopped – handful
For Paneer Sandwich
- Bread Slices – 8 nos
- Butter – 4 tbsp
- Mint Chutney – ½ cup
This Matar Paneer Sandwich is an excellent breakfast option, food for picnic baskets, tiffin and for kids lunch box or any time of the day snack.First step is to prepare the stuffing for this tasty sandwich. Melt butter in a pan and add cumin, stir and add green peas. Sprinkle some salt and cook on high heat for 2-3 mins and then remove them to a bowl. Use a potato masher to crush the potatoes. Do not make a paste of the peas.Crush and add paneer to it along with onions, ginger, green chilli, salt, coriander seeds, chilli powder, kasoori Methi, chaat masala and anardana (pomegranate seeds dried). Anardana is optional here. Sprinkle some garam masala and freshly chopped coriander. Mix this and check and correct the seasoning. The mixture is ready and this can be used for a paratha, roll or a sandwich. For making a sandwich, smear soft butter on one side of the sliced bread. Place the butter side down and then apply some mint chutney on one slice of the bread. Then generously palace the matar paneer filling and then cover it with another slice of bread. Again, the butter side of the slice has to be on the top.Repeat the same with the remaining slices. Now you can make a sandwich in a toastie or sandwich griller or can cook it on a pan or tawa. Make sure to heat the tawa to medium hot and then cook on both sides till the bread gently browns and turns crispy. Remove, cut and serve it hot.
